Permaculture is, amongst others, an approach to land management that adopts arrangements observed in flourishing natural ecosystems. It includes a set of design principles derived using whole systems thinking. It uses these principles in fields such as regenerative agriculture, rewilding, and community resilience. Permaculture discourages monoculture and serves to open up the possibility of growing a wide range of food grains, fruits and vegetables and thereby expanding the food basket; thus permaculture also contributes to community health. Mulch is a material placed on the soil surface to maintain moisture, reduce weed growth, mitigate soil erosion and improve soil conditions.
